mysql-8.0.15下载与安装,并于python连接,实现文件导入并将结果输出到excel中

1.下载MySql
官网下载地址: https://dev.mysql.com/downloads/mysql/
(一般选64位的,windows(x86,64-bit).ZIP Archive)

2.安装
解压,我的解压目录为:D:\mysql-8.0.15-winx64
CMD,以管理员身份运行
d:(进入d盘)
cd mysql-8.0.15-winx64\bin(进入bin目录)
进入mysql子目录bin
(安装)mysqld --intall
(初始化)mysqld --initialize
(启用)net start mysql

3.设置登陆密码
在这里插入图片描述mysql目录里有个data文件夹,里面有个.err文件,里面有root@localhost:xxxxxx,xxxxxxx为默认密码,登录就可以,
mysql -u root -p
不过需要修改密码,通过一下语句
ALTER USER ‘root’@‘localhost’ IDENTIFIED WITH mysql_native_password BY ‘新密码’;我的新密码是123456.
下一次可以通过环境变量,快速进入mysql,链接https://blog.youkuaiyun.com/li93675/article/details/80700152

4.python3.X需要下载pymysql,通过命令pip install pymysql就可以
通过命令行导入文件,
create database wzet(库名);
use wzet;
source 文件名.sql(将文件放入bin目录下)
show tables
desc 表名(表名,上一个命令下面有,可以查看自己是否导入成功)

在这里插入图片描述在这里插入图片描述在这里插入图片描述
同时也要下载xlwt:
在这里插入图片描述查询有多条数据结果时:(在MySQL中是null,而在Python中则是None)
cursor.fetchone():将只返回一条结果,返回单个元组如(‘id’,‘name’)。
然后多次循环使用cursor.fetchone(),依次取得下一条结果,直到为空
cursor.fetchall() :也将返回所有结果,返回二维元组,如((‘id’,‘name’),(‘id’,‘name’))。

评论
添加红包

请填写红包祝福语或标题

红包个数最小为10个

红包金额最低5元

当前余额3.43前往充值 >
需支付:10.00
成就一亿技术人!
领取后你会自动成为博主和红包主的粉丝 规则
hope_wisdom
发出的红包
实付
使用余额支付
点击重新获取
扫码支付
钱包余额 0

抵扣说明:

1.余额是钱包充值的虚拟货币,按照1:1的比例进行支付金额的抵扣。
2.余额无法直接购买下载,可以购买VIP、付费专栏及课程。

余额充值